Born in Denerim’s Alienage during one of the coldest winters, son of Antoria Surana and a mage from Ferelden Circle of Magi. Sickly as a child, he had a happy enough childhood with a mother that cared about him deeply. Taken to the Circle at age of seven, his magical potential being discovered by accident by a Chantry healer.
First years in the Circle were the hardest for Vergil - taken away from his mother, thrust into completely new environment, awoken magical ability that he couldn’t control properly, pressure from new teachers that wanted him to make progress in writing, reading and magic lessons as quickly as possible, rules to be learnt, templars to be feared and other apprentices and mages to co-exist with. Quiet, shy and depressed he had no choice but to prevail or give in to the whispers of creatures haunting him in his dreams and perish.
After learning his letters good enough to read silently, Vergil discovered his passion for knowledge. Books and research helped him greatly with building his confidence in using magic, as well as the encouragement of his teachers. He embraced his affinity to cold magic and with few bumps on the road during his magical training he found out a talent in another field. Interested in the school of spirit, Vergil experimented with spells when no one was looking, as one accident with a fire spell gone wrong during classes taught him to hide his findings.
Getting older, Vergil’s personality and looks changed - as he became more self-confident and arrogant his charm over others has grown as well. Something he wasn’t beyond using for his personal gain, be it for a favour or just for pleasure. Not friendly enough to be liked by everyone but his good looks and wits helped him with staying afloat in the group of apprentices. Harrowed two years before the Blight he started a study in seemingly two opposite fields - primal and spirit.

Conscription to the Grey Wardens was a great surprise but also a chance for Vergil to leave the Circle and see the world much sooner than he’d planned. Open world, with its environment and people turned out to be harsh for the young mage, though given his heritage and upbringing it wasn't as much of a shock as it could be.
Pushed into the role of the leader after tragic events of Ostagar, at first Vergil stumbled a lot, masking his ignorance and doubt with cold indifference. The life on the road, dynamic with the group, responsibility for his decisions and a few serious clashes with his fellow Warden and many other bumps on their journey shaped him into a different person than he was before the Blight. More focused, diplomatic with knack for strategy, always weighing pros and cons of decisions.
With help of his friend, Morrigan, Vergil discovered his magical talent anew. Unlearning years of Circle teachings and exploring his potential for much more than he thought was possible. Vergil started experimenting with original spells as well as “classic” magic, taking notes of the combinations, effects and other results in journals. His journey with blood magic started as an accident but it didn’t make him shy from it, quite the contrary - his curiosity spurred him to use it more whenever possible and with time he started to be aware of the Fade creature that observed him for years.
After the Blight Vergil accepted the official title of Commander Of the Grey Wardens in Ferelden and slipped into the role as it’s made for him. The position gave him a lot of freedom and he found himself thriving while working on solving many problems of the order and arling under his care.
